krb5 (1.4.3-2) unstable; urgency=low
.
* Conflict with libauthen-krb5-perl (<< 1.4-5) because of krb5_init_ets.
* Update uploader address.
* Conflict with libapache-mod-auth-kerb because it accesses library internals in a way that breaks.
.
krb5 (1.4.3-1) experimental; urgency=low
.
* New upstream release.
* Install ac_check_krb5 for use by aclocal.
.
krb5 (1.4.2-1) UNRELEASED; urgency=low
.
* New upstream version. (Closes: #293077)
- kadmind4, v5passwdd, and v5passwd are no longer included.
- Increase the libkrb53 shlibs version dependency. Programs linked
against this version will not work with an older libkrb53.
- Rebuild should fix link problems on powerpc. (Closes: #329709)
* Re-enable optimization on m68k to stop hiding the toolchain problem.
* Don't build crypto code -O3. It uncovers too many gcc bugs.
* Fix compilation on Hurd. Thanks, Michael Banck. (Closes: #324305)
* Always initialize the output token in gss_init_sec_context, even with
an unknown mechanism. (Closes: #311977)
* rcp should fall back to /usr/bin/netkit-rcp, not /usr/bin/rpc.
* Add the missing shared library depends for libkadm55.
* Use dh_install rather than dh_movefiles and enable --fail-missing to
be sure to pick up any new upstream files.
* Avoid test -a in maintainer scripts.
* Expand and reformat the documentation and sample kdc.conf file.
* Add a doc-base file for the krb425 migration guide.
* Ignore lintian warnings about the library package names. We'll fix
them the next time upstream changes SONAMEs.
* Conflict with packages that used internal symbols not part of the
public ABI
* Use "MIT Kerberos" rather than krb5 in the krb5-doc short description.
* Remove the saved patches that have been applied upstream or are no
longer applied to the package, update the remaining patches, and move
them into debian/patches.
* Break out the other patches of interest for ease submitting them
upstream.
* Translation updates.
- Vietnamese, thanks Clytie Siddall. (Closes: #319704)
